Community engagement is vital in CCF participation as it fosters a sense of connection and responsibility towards local initiatives. Through community engagement, Cadets have the opportunity to apply the skills and values learned within CCF in real-world contexts. This involvement can lead to the development and support of local programs that benefit the community, such as environmental projects, volunteering for community services, and promoting public awareness on various issues.

Involvement in local initiatives not only enhances the personal development of Cadets but also strengthens the bond between the CCF and the communities they serve. This collaboration demonstrates the CCF’s commitment to making a positive impact, thereby nurturing leadership skills, social responsibility, and teamwork among Cadets. Furthermore, engaging with the community allows Cadets to represent their organization positively, showcasing the values of the CCF and encouraging a spirit of service that transcends the training environment.
